Какво се прави, докато е в PostgreSQL?
Какво се прави, докато е в PostgreSQL?

Видео: Какво се прави, докато е в PostgreSQL?

Видео: Какво се прави, докато е в PostgreSQL?
Видео: Любовь и голуби (FullHD, комедия, реж. Владимир Меньшов, 1984 г.) 2024, Ноември
Anonim

В ДОКАТО loop оператор изпълнява блок от изрази до условие се оценява на false. В ДОКАТО цикъл изявление, PostgreSQL оценява условието преди да изпълни блока от изрази. Ако условието е вярно, блокът от изрази се изпълнява до той се оценява като фалшив.

Също така въпросът е какво се изпълнява в PostgreSQL?

Той се задава от всеки от следните типове изрази: Инструкцията SELECT INTO задава FOUND истина, ако е присвоен ред, false, ако не е върнат ред. А ИЗПЪЛНЯВАЙТЕ операторът задава FOUND true, ако произвежда (и отхвърля) един или повече редове, false, ако не е произведен ред.

блокира ли Postgres? НАПРАВЕТЕ изпълнява анонимен код блок , или с други думи преходна анонимна функция на процедурен език. Кодът блок се третира така, сякаш е тялото на функция без параметри, връщайки void. Той се анализира и изпълнява еднократно.

Освен това, как да напиша if изрази в PostgreSQL?

В IF изявление е част от процедурния език по подразбиране PL/pgSQL. Трябва да създадете функция или да изпълните ad-hoc изявление с командата DO. Трябва ти; в края на всеки изявление в plpgsql (с изключение на крайния END). Трябва ти КРАЙ АКО ; в края на IF изявление.

Как да стартирам функция в Greenplum?

Използването на присвояване и оператори SELECT за изпълнява функции е стандартен в PL/ pgSQL защото всички функции в PostgreSQL базата данни трябва да върне стойност от някакъв тип. Използвайте ключовата дума PERFORM за повикване а функция и игнорирайте неговите върнати данни. Пример 11-50 показва синтаксиса на ключовата дума PERFORM.

Препоръчано: